Sergio Llull bids farewell to the Spanish national team: "I've given everything, even my body."

The Real Madrid point guard has announced his departure from the national team after a distinguished career in which he managed to accumulate seven medals and participated in 173 international matches. The decision marks the end of an era for Spanish basketball, in which the player was a key piece of a cycle of successes in European and World championships. His on-court ability and leadership within the team have been fundamental in consolidating Spain as a powerhouse in this sport, leaving a legacy that will be remembered for generations.

Despite his retirement from the national team, the player has expressed his desire to continue his career with Real Madrid, the club with which he has won multiple titles and gained recognition at the European level. The choice to focus their efforts on their club not only responds to the need to manage their sports career, but also to extend their time on the court in an environment they consider their home. This decision has been well received by the Madrid club's fans, who value its commitment and hope to continue celebrating its achievements in the league.
